Multi fuel stoves are highly efficient heating systems that can be used for various fuels, including wood, coal and smokeless fuels. Certain models are equipped with advanced features, for instance, an airwash system which keeps the glass front clean from deposits and soot. This feature decreases the need for manual cleaning, and improves the appearance of your stove. Cleanburn technology is another feature that optimizes combustion and reduces emissions, thereby saving you money on fuel and aiding the environment.

It is crucial to determine the stove's clearance requirements. This is the distance it must be kept from combustible materials like wallpaper, curtains and furniture. For a safer, more comfortable home, you must also install carbon monoxide detectors. CO alarms detect dangerous levels of this colorless, odourless gas. They will sound an alarm and flash lights to warn you. It is recommended to choose a HETAS-certified installation expert to install your stove and ensure that the installation meets the regulations.
